DHIFI’s mission of advancing a social emotional learning curriculum for students begins with Meg Zucker. Founder and president of Don’t Hide It, Flaunt It, Meg Zucker is among inclusion and inclusion’s most passionate supporters. Born with a genetic condition known as ectrodactyly, Meg has accepted her uniqueness and devoted her life to assisting others in doing the same. She has used her experiences to empower individuals to recognize their special qualities with a legal career spanning decades and a personal dedication to encouraging compassion and inclusion. Her dream and leadership consistently motivate adults and children alike to live authentically and celebrate what makes them special.
